1. Platform Compatibility

Platform compatibility directly influences the method required to store animated image files on mobile devices. Variations in operating system design, security protocols, and application programming interfaces (APIs) necessitate different procedures for saving GIFs across iOS and Android. The effect is that a single method does not guarantee success on every device or within every application. Understanding compatibility is a crucial component of successfully storing GIFs on a mobile phone.

For instance, on Android, saving a GIF from a web browser frequently involves a long press on the image, which then prompts a “Save image” option. Conversely, iOS may require utilizing the share sheet function after a long press to access a “Save image” option. Some third-party applications, such as messaging platforms, might integrate their own GIF saving functionality, which bypasses the operating system’s native methods. Consequently, a user accustomed to saving GIFs on one platform may encounter difficulties when switching to another without understanding these compatibility nuances.

2. Direct Download

Direct download represents a primary method for storing animated images on mobile devices and is a core component of resolving the query “how do i save gifs to my phone.” This process involves directly retrieving the GIF file from a web server or other online source and saving it to the device’s local storage. The ability to perform a direct download is often contingent on the website’s design and the user’s device operating system. In many cases, a long press on the GIF image within a web browser will trigger a menu that includes a “Save image” or similar option. This action initiates the download process, transferring the GIF from the server to the phone’s storage.

However, direct download functionality is not universally available across all websites or GIF hosting platforms. Some sites may employ mechanisms to prevent direct downloads, either to protect intellectual property or to encourage users to share content through designated social media channels. In such cases, alternative methods, such as screen recording or utilizing third-party GIF downloader applications, may be required to preserve the animated image. 3. App Integration

App integration represents a significant facet in understanding “how do i save gifs to my phone,” affecting the user’s ability to store and manage animated images. Many applications, especially those focused on social media and messaging, incorporate their own methods for handling GIF content, bypassing the device’s native saving mechanisms. This necessitates understanding how each application’s unique features relate to GIF storage.

  • Native GIF Libraries

    Some applications, such as messaging platforms, maintain internal GIF libraries accessible directly within the app. Saving a GIF in this context might involve adding it to a “favorites” section or a similar collection within the app itself, rather than storing it as a separate file on the device. This approach allows for easy access within the application but may limit the GIF’s availability for use in other contexts.

  • Custom Download Mechanisms

    Certain apps implement custom download mechanisms specific to their platform. For example, a social media app might offer a “Download” button directly on a GIF post. The process of saving via this button can differ from the standard long-press method used in web browsers. Understanding these application-specific workflows is critical for saving GIFs effectively.

  • Third-Party App Limitations

    Third-party applications that access GIF content from other sources might impose limitations on saving. These limitations could arise from copyright concerns, API restrictions, or the app developer’s design choices. In such scenarios, users might be unable to save GIFs directly through the app and must resort to alternative methods, such as screen recording or seeking out the GIF’s original source.

  • Share Sheet Integration

    Many applications integrate with the operating system’s share sheet, allowing users to share GIFs to other applications or save them to the device’s photo library. Utilizing the share sheet can be a versatile way to save GIFs from apps that do not offer a direct download option. However, the availability and functionality of the share sheet depend on the operating system and the specific app’s implementation.

Frequently Asked Questions

The following addresses common inquiries and clarifies procedures for storing animated images on mobile phones. Each question is addressed directly, providing practical information.

Question 1: Why does the “Save Image” option not appear when long-pressing a GIF in certain apps?

The absence of the “Save Image” option often indicates that the application has implemented a custom method for handling GIFs, bypassing the operating system’s default behavior. The application may require utilizing its internal share function or a designated download button to save the GIF. Consult the application’s help documentation for specific instructions.

Question 2: What if a GIF appears static after being saved to the phone?

A static GIF display suggests a problem with format compatibility or a corrupted file. Ensure the mobile device supports the GIF format and that the file was completely downloaded without interruption. Try opening the GIF with a different image viewer application to rule out specific software issues. Redownloading the GIF from the original source may resolve file corruption.

Question 3: Is it possible to save GIFs from social media applications that do not offer a direct download option?

When direct download options are unavailable, screen recording or utilizing third-party applications designed to extract media from social media platforms can be considered. However, the legality and ethical implications of such methods should be carefully evaluated, particularly concerning copyright and terms of service.

Question 4: Where are saved GIFs typically located on a mobile device?

By default, saved GIFs are often placed in the “Downloads” folder or a general “Images” directory. The specific location can vary depending on the browser or application used to save the GIF. File manager applications can be employed to locate and organize saved files if the default location is unknown.

Question 5: Does saving a GIF consume a significant amount of storage space on a mobile device?

GIF file sizes can vary significantly depending on resolution, frame rate, and color depth. Longer and more complex GIFs will naturally consume more storage space. Regularly reviewing and deleting unwanted GIFs can help manage storage capacity.

Question 6: What are the limitations of using third-party GIF downloader applications?

Third-party GIF downloader applications carry inherent risks, including potential security vulnerabilities, privacy concerns, and the possibility of containing malware. Exercise caution when installing and using such applications, ensuring they are obtained from reputable sources and thoroughly vetted.
